A066738 Primes that are concatenations of nonprime numbers. 0
11, 19, 41, 61, 89, 101, 109, 127, 139, 149, 151, 157, 163, 181, 191, 193, 199, 211, 229, 241, 251, 269, 271, 281, 331, 349, 359, 389, 401, 409, 419, 421, 433, 439, 449, 457, 461, 463, 487, 491, 499, 509, 521, 541, 569, 571, 601, 619, 631, 641, 659, 661 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; internal format)
OFFSET

1,1

EXAMPLE

The prime 163 is the concatenation of nonprime numbers 1 and 63. 419 is the concatenation of 4, 1 and 9.
